Golden Pan-Seared Salmon with Zesty Asparagus
Fresh salmon fillets pan-seared until golden and crisp, paired with tender asparagus spears brightened by a zesty lemon-garlic finish.
INGREDIENTS
7 oz Salmon fillet
1 cup Asparagus spears
1 tsp Extra virgin olive oil
0.5 tsp Sea salt
0.25 tsp Black pepper
1 clove Garlic
1 tsp Lemon zest
1 tbsp Lemon juice
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et completely dry with a paper towel and season both sides with sea salt and black pepper.
Heat the extra virgin olive oil in a medium non-stick sk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ering.
Place the salmon in the pan skin-side down and press gently with a spatula to ensure even contact for a crispy finish.
Sear for 4-5 minutes until the skin is golden, then flip and cook for another 2-3 minutes until desired doneness.
Add the asparagus spears and minced garlic to the pan during the last 3 minutes of cooking, tossing until bright green.
Remove from heat, sprinkle with lemon zest, and drizzle with fresh lemon juice before serving.
